Summary
Surgery for infective endocarditis is evolving. Key indications include heart failure, emboli, resistant infection, large vegetations, and deep tissue issues, guiding clinical management.

Background:
- The optimal timing for surgical intervention in infective endocarditis remains a complex clinical decision.
- Standard antibiotic therapy is the cornerstone of endocarditis treatment, but surgical management is sometimes necessary.
- Evolving evidence influences the indications for early surgical intervention.
Purpose of the Study:
- To review the current indications for surgical intervention in infective endocarditis.
- To critically analyze the existing literature supporting surgical management.
- To propose evidence-based guidelines for the clinical management of endocarditis patients requiring surgery.
Main Methods:
- Literature review of studies on surgical intervention in infective endocarditis.
- Analysis of common indications: heart failure, recurrent emboli, resistant infections, large vegetations, and deep tissue involvement.
- Consideration of prosthetic valve endocarditis with non-streptococcal pathogens.
Main Results:
- Heart failure, repeated emboli, resistant infection, large vegetations, and deep tissue involvement are primary surgical indications.
- Prosthetic valve endocarditis caused by non-streptococcal pathogens may warrant early replacement.
- The decision for surgery is multifactorial, balancing risks and benefits.
Conclusions:
- Surgical intervention plays a crucial role in select cases of infective endocarditis.
- Clear guidelines are needed to standardize the management of patients requiring surgery.
- Early surgical consideration can improve outcomes in complicated endocarditis cases.
